Some expect cities and counties to care for homeless residents. Others say it punishes vulnerable people. By Alex LiebermanOriginal Air Date: May 21, 2025Host: Florida House Bill 1365 went into effect on October 1 of last year, and its enforcement began in January. The law bans sleeping or camping on public property that is not designated by the Florida Department of Children and Families (DCF). Counties and municipalities can be sued for not complying.
